Biography

Benson Lim is an Associate Professor in the School of Built Environment at the University of New South Wales. He holds a PhD from the National University of Singapore, a Bachelor of Building and Construction Management from UNSW, and a Diploma in Building and Real Estate from Ngee Ann Polytechnic. His primary research focuses on sustainable construction business practices, social procurement, corporate social responsibility, and facility management. Over the years, Dr. Lim has earned various awards, including the UNSW Dean's Teaching Excellence Award and the UNSW Scientia Education Fellow recognition. He has published extensively in his area of expertise, with notable awards for papers presented at international conferences. He teaches courses in Construction Business Strategy, Strategic Facilities Management, and Business Intelligence Data Analytics, and has been recognized multiple times for his teaching excellence. Additionally, Dr. Lim is committed to supervising postgraduate research and enhancing the learning experiences of his students through innovative teaching methodologies.
